Output fdb4023f8ef5ec4288bf12e9b1b19853dc977466ef9680963f32be29e20fa624:14

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ddb0fd4b0b3c4ebb4da2b62096ff51e7a565461 OP_EQUALVERIFY OP_CHECKSIG
address
12GGDBH9vpFgyzMbzecmt4DwZFtV5HKZCh
transaction
fdb4023f8ef5ec4288bf12e9b1b19853dc977466ef9680963f32be29e20fa624
confirmations
493881
spent
true